Generational Forgetting

The idea that each new generation forgets what the previous generation learned. As used here, the term refers to knowledge about the harm drugs can do.

Identity Diffusion

A state in psychological development where an individual lacks a clear and defined sense of identity or self-concept.

Identity Status

A conceptual framework developed by James Marcia that categorizes the process of identity development in adolescence through the exploration of various commitments and beliefs.

Psychosocial Development

A theory proposed by Erik Erikson that human development is a series of eight stages that extends from infancy to adulthood, with each stage centered on resolving a fundamental conflict.
